The First-Time Buyer: Focus on Simplicity and Reliability

For beginners, the world of outboard motors can seem overwhelming. First-time buyers typically look for engines that are easy to install, operate, and maintain. Smaller motors like 2.5HP to 25HP are perfect for small fishing boats or dinghies. Brands like Yamaha, Mercury, and Honda offer beginner-friendly models with pull-starts and tiller steering. Reliability is the number one factor here—no one wants to be stranded on the water due to engine failure. A good warranty and local service support are also key.

The Performance Enthusiast: Speed, Horsepower, and Advanced Tech

Speed demons and performance junkies focus on engines with high horsepower (90HP–300HP+), fuel injection, and digital controls. These buyers often search for the latest technology—like digital throttle and shift systems (DTS), electronic fuel injection (EFI), and multi-function displays. Mercury’s Verado or Yamaha’s V MAX SHO series are popular among this crowd. The Eco-Conscious Boater: Going Electric or 4-Stroke

Eco-conscious shoppers are steering toward quieter, cleaner, and more fuel-efficient motors. The rise of electric outboard motors like Torqeedo and ePropulsion appeals to those who want zero emissions and low maintenance. Traditional gas-powered users are shifting toward 4-stroke engines, which are quieter, cleaner, and more fuel-efficient than older 2-stroke models. The Budget-Conscious Shopper: Used and Refurbished Deals

Not everyone can afford a brand-new outboard motor. Budget-conscious buyers often explore used or refurbished outboard motors, aiming to get the best value without compromising too much on quality. Websites like Craigslist, Facebook Marketplace, and marine-specific retailers offer plenty of options. However, buyers in this category need to be cautious—checking hours of usage, compression levels, and whether the engine has been regularly serviced is critical. The Commercial Operator: Durability and Heavy-Duty Performance

Commercial operators such as fishing charters, rescue teams, and ferry services need powerful, reliable, and long-lasting outboard motors. These buyers look for brands and models known for ruggedness, such as Suzuki’s DF series or Honda’s BF outboards. Service intervals, fuel economy under heavy loads, and parts availability are crucial. Commercial buyers usually purchase in bulk or partner with authorized dealers to receive support and volume discounts.
